| Three format septic tank-Constructed wetland |
The cost of each set of four grid purification tank project is about2000~3000first |
No equipment operating costs |
daily schedule1Regular maintenance is required, and the three format septic tank is cleaned annually1Secondly, during the peak season of plant growth in artificial wetlands, timely harvesting should be carried out, and plant residues should be cleaned up promptly in winter. |
| anaerobic tank-Facultative filter tank |
The per capita construction cost of the system is approximately200~300first |
No equipment operating costs |
daily schedule1Regular maintenance by humans, annual cleaning of anaerobic tanks1Secondary, aerobic filter media3~5Replace once a year |
| Anaerobic hydrolysis tank-Oxidation pond-Ecological Gully |
The per capita construction cost of the system is approximately150~250first |
No equipment operating costs |
daily schedule1Regular maintenance by personnel, annual cleaning of anaerobic hydrolysis tank1Secondly, aquatic plants should be harvested in a timely manner during the peak growth season, and aquatic plant residues should be cleaned up in a timely manner during winter. |
| Composite media biofilter |
4000~9000first/Ton of water (excluding pipeline network) |
The energy consumption cost is less than0.15first/Ton, can also be powered by solar energy to achieve zero energy consumption. |
Operation and maintenance are simplified, and the combined process system operates automatically without human supervision |
| A2/O-Constructed wetland |
The average construction cost per system household is approximately800~1000first |
No equipment operating costs |
Regularly (once every quarter) clean and maintain grid wells, contact oxidation channels, artificial wetlands, and related ditches; Regularly clean up weeds, pests, and plant residues in the artificial wetland, and harvest and replace plants in the artificial wetland. |
| Integrated sewage treatment technology |
4800-9800first/Ton of water |
Unit water consumption0.6-1.0kw.h/m3Direct operating cost per unit of water volume0.7-1.0first/m3The price per ton of water1.2-2.56Yuan (including maintenance costs) |
